IV. Characteristics of the brazen serpent.
A. Compare the first Adam to the second Adam.
1. God didn't want Moses to hang a dead serpent on the rod.
2. That wouldn't do any good.
3. It had to be a serpent in the likeness of a deadly serpent, yet without any poison.
B. Brass is symbolic of the judgment of God.
1. If lost people will face the judgment of God against themselves, they will be saved.
C. The serpent was lifted up very high so all the people could see.
1. There were some 2,400,000 people in Israel, and any of them could see.
2. There are millions of people on the earth today, and all of the should be able to see.
